Appliance Repair Services in Pretoria, Gauteng
In Pretoria, Gauteng, appliance repair services cover a wide range of household and commercial machines, helping households restore functionality with minimal disruption. Trained technicians typically handle major domestic appliances such as refrigerators, freezers, washing machines, tumble dryers, dishwashers, electric ovens and stoves, microwaves, and air-conditioning units, as well as smaller items like irons and food preparation appliances. The breadth of expertise reflects common household needs in a city characterised by variable weather and electricity supply challenges.
Service providers commonly begin with an initial assessment to determine whether a fault is electrical, mechanical, or related to wear and tear. Many repairs involve diagnostic checks to identify faulty components—such as thermostats, seals, heating elements, motors, compressors, or control boards—before advising on feasibility and cost. In Pretoria, customers often seek quick, reliable responses due to daily routines that rely on functional appliances for cooking, cleaning, and preservation of perishable goods. Technicians typically offer on-site call-outs within a standard radius of major suburbs and townships, with some larger operations providing satellite workshops for more extensive repairs.
Typical work sequences include a visit to inspect the appliance, a diagnostic report, estimate of repair costs, and the sourcing of replacement parts if needed. In many cases, parts availability within Gauteng can influence turnaround times. When a repair is not economical or parts are unavailable, technicians may recommend alternatives such as component refurbishment, temporary replacements, or improving efficiency through servicing or reconditioning. It is common for technicians to implement safety checks to protect against electrical hazards and to ensure compliance with any local electrical regulations or manufacturer recommendations.
Customers can expect several practical considerations when arranging appliance repairs in Pretoria. First, many service providers operate on a call-out basis, with a displayed or negotiated diagnostic fee that is sometimes offset against the final bill if a repair proceeds. Second, appointment scheduling often aligns with the customer’s routine, and some firms indicate preferred windows for arrival. Third, the warranty landscape varies: repaired appliances may carry a limited warranty on parts and workmanship, while certain higher‑value components can be covered by manufacturer or supplier guarantees depending on the part and the service arrangement. It is prudent to clarify whether the quote includes labour, parts, and any aftercare, and to obtain a written estimate before authorising work.
Electrical reliability is a practical concern in Pretoria, where load shedding and power surges can impact appliances. Technicians may advise on surge protection measures, proper venting for cooling appliances, and routine maintenance checks to extend service life. Regular cleaning of filters, unclogging of drainage systems, verification of seals and door latches, and lubrication of moving parts contribute to longer appliance life and improved performance. For households and small businesses, keeping a record of service history helps in tracking warranty periods and planning preventative maintenance.
